Research And Design Of The Paper Currency Classification System Based On Dual Core Processor

In recent years, with the rapid development of modern economy, worn, defaced money in the currency in circulation is becoming more and more. It hindered the circulation of commodities, and caused inconvenience to people’s daily life. But the work that Classification of the coins is still largely rely on manual processing, the disadvantage that Low efficiency, poor quality caused by manual processing brings a heavy burden to the financial system, Therefore, banks and other financial institutions need a high-performance Financial Equipments, especially the urgent demand for the Paper-Money-Classification-Equipment (PMCE), and the PMCE is showing its huge economic and social benefits.The paper carried out a detailed analysis and discussion about the Image feature of the paper money and the Image processing theory at first, and then Analyzes and compares the advantages and disadvantages of the Traditional methods that used in the paper money classification, and proposes a new algorithm about the paper money classification at last. The paper contains five parts as following:the classification of money’s face value, the classification of the worn money, the classification of money’s Orientation, the classification of money’s old condition, the classification of money’s edition.The algorism that classifying the money’s face value is based on the color recognition theory in the HSV color space, so as the classification of money’s edition, it determines the version of the money by Identifying the Color information of Crown Code. The classification of money’s Orientation is based on HMM theory, and the method is a statistical method. The algorithm proposes the idea of Block Histogram and it identifies the level of the money’s old condition.The algorithm that classifying the worn money is formed by joining the morphological filtering theory to the Background area statistical methods. And it used to remove the Small stains and reduce the calculation errors. Simulation results show that:The algorithms Mentioned above have the advantages that easy to implement, high fault tolerance, effective, and so on. And the algorism meets the requirements of the classification system.Two classification system platforms are designed and implemented in the paper at the same time, one is designed with Atom-Core, and the other is designed with the OMAP-L137-Core. Through the actual test and analysis, the system platform with OMAP-L137-Core is selected as the classification system Platform.It uses the latest dual-core processor chip OMAP L137as the core, FPGA as a coprocessor; the OMAP-L137processor is supported by TI’s Software system and with a high speed, Strong anti-jamming capability. So, the system designed in the paper has the more simple hardware circuit compared with the previous system, and it is low-cost, easy to extend, Easy to install and debugged, Practical tests prove the system is stable and fast.
